On my '92, the "top" and "bottom" are the same. [I put them in quotes, since the top is bottom and bottom is top when you open the hatch.] Both have a metal wire clip; once you've put the ball [on the hatch or frame] into the socket [on the strut], the straight end of the clip fits through a hole in the socket, and then the curled end snaps around the body of the strut. Actually pretty clever.

But if people are talking about metal brackets, then some models are different than others.
